I want to tell you about my childish dream.
When I was a little girl (at about 6 years old) I was eager to have a sister, to brash and set her hair, to nurse her and to play with her. One day my mother said that soon there will be a little baby in our family, my little brother. I didn't believe her; I didn't even want to hear that. When we together with my grandma were informed about the birth of my brother I was shocked!
I went into hysteric sobbing violently and crying about big doctors' mistake. I was more than serious arguing about it as if being a grown-up. With a furious movement I overturned a chair, rushed to the door, went out, and immediately was back with my eyes full of tears.
Many years have gone since that day. We still don't get on. Each of us prefers to live his own life. It's a pity I know.
But I have embodied my dream to have a little sister in my little daughter and named her as my sister was presupposed to be named.
Her name is Diana. :)
